American Messaging strives to maintain high standards for the protection of privacy over the Internet. The purpose of this statement is to explain to our visitors the type of information American Messaging obtains about visitors to our websites, how we gather it, how we use it, how long we retain it, and how visitors can restrict the use or disclosure of personally identifiable information.

Information we collect
The personal information American Messaging obtains about individual visitors to our websites is information the visitor supplies voluntarily. This means that you can visit our websites without telling us who you are or revealing any information about yourself. To gauge the effectiveness of our websites, we do collect some generic information about our visitors. Our web servers automatically recognize a visitor's domain name (such as .com, .edu, etc.), the point of entry from which a visitor enters our site including web pages, User Guide CDs or banner ads, which pages a visitor visits on our site, and how much time a visitor spends on each page. We use web beacons (a.k.a. clear gifs) to track use of our site and to track what sites users came from and go to after leaving our site. We do not track user activity on sites outside of American Messaging. We aggregate this information and use it to evaluate and improve our websites.

Use of cookies
American Messaging websites also use "cookies". They allow us to serve you better. When you use our site we send information, a cookie, to your computer and it is stored there. When you return to our site, your computer sends the cookie back to us. This allows our server to recognize your computer and any settings you created on our site. It restores those settings so you don't have to enter the same information every time you visit. The fact that our server recognizes your computer when it retrieves the cookies does not mean that American Messaging is actually acquiring personally identifiable information about you. You can set your browser to delete cookies or to tell you before you accept one. Look in your browser's Options or Preferences menu.
